책 내용 질문하기
엑세스 2017년 상시 기출 문제4-3 메세지박스 구현 변수a 사용유무
도서
2023 시나공 컴퓨터활용능력 1급 실기
페이지
0
조회수
136
작성일
2023-10-24
작성자
탈퇴*원
첨부파일
엑세스 2017년 상시 기출 문제4-3 메세지박스 구현 변수a 사용유무
정답은
MsgBox "오늘 날짜는 " & Date & "입니다."
txt년 = Year(Date)
txt월 = Month(Date)
인데, 저는 아래처럼 a변수 사용해서 작성했거든요.
Dim a
a = MsgBox("오늘 날짜는 " & Date & "입니다.", vbOKOnly)
If a = vbOKOnly Then
txt년 = Year(Date)
txt월 = Month(Date)
End If
그런데 실행해 보니 txt년도와 txt월에 확인을 클릭해도 날짜입력이 안되더라구요.
왜 그런가요?? dim a로 풀면 안되나요??
답변
2023-10-25 12:21:38
안녕하세요.
a 변수와 if 문을 사용하는 경우는 메시지 박스에 여러 단추가 있고, 그 단추 중 어떤 단추를 클릭했냐에 따라 다른 결과를 실행하기 위해 사용하는 것입니다. 메시지 박스에 <확인> 단추 하나만 있는데 사용할 필요가 없겠죠.
즐거운 하루 되세요.
-
관리자2023-10-25 12:21:38
안녕하세요.
a 변수와 if 문을 사용하는 경우는 메시지 박스에 여러 단추가 있고, 그 단추 중 어떤 단추를 클릭했냐에 따라 다른 결과를 실행하기 위해 사용하는 것입니다. 메시지 박스에 <확인> 단추 하나만 있는데 사용할 필요가 없겠죠.
즐거운 하루 되세요.